About this House

Multiple offers received, please submit best and final by 3pm 4-8-18 This well maintained, one-owner home shows pride of ownership. This home offers a downstairs living area and an upstairs game room big enough for a pool table. The master bedroom is downstairs with a roomy walk-in closet, double sinks, jetted tub and separate shower. The covered back patio has a recently tiled floor that is spacious enough for entertaining. The backyard is set up with a children's play area, that will remain with the home. Close proximity to Bell Helicopter, Tesco Park, and TRE park and ride. Easy access to 121, 820 and 183.
